What is the average price of a hotel in Macau this weekend?

According to the latest 12-month data from Trip.com, the average price for a 3-star hotel in Macau this weekend is €135 per night. For a 4-star hotel, the average cost is €186 per night. If you're looking for a luxury experience, 5-star hotels in Macau this weekend typically cost €703 per night.

How much do hotels in Macau cost per night on weekdays?

Based on the latest 12-month data from Trip.com, the average price for a 3-star hotel in Macau during weekdays is €86 per night. For a 4-star hotel, you can expect to pay around €132 per night. If you're seeking a luxury stay, 5-star hotels in Macau generally cost €514 per night on weekdays.
